Ouhrabka V. & Mlejnek R.: Caves Being Created – Crevice Caves
In the Czech Republic, about 250 crevice caves have been registered in geologically diverse bedrock. Cervices often resulted from gravitational movements of rock blocks along tectonic or non-tectonic fissures.

Jandová J. & Holá E.: The Dicranium Moss – A Rare Moss Species
By the Red List of Threatened Species in the Czech Republic (Kučera & Váňa 2005), the epiphytis moss Dicranum viride is considered as Endangered within the country.
